我在Laravel中有一个用于任务管理的项目,我只想添加进度条来控制我的任务状态,从开始到完成,我在任务表列中添加调用进度的内容整数来定义任务进度,我在视图中添加进度条,如:
<progress id="file" value="32" max="100" style="width: 542px;"> 32% </progress>
我试图编辑您的问题,但队列已满。
因此,如果我理解得很好,您有一个backend table
任务,其中有一列进度
然后,您希望使用设计的progress-bar
显示frontend table
中的所有任务。
需要更清晰:
- 如何填充数据库
progress
列?是后台/系统任务,实时还是逐步进度 - 您是否在显示或更新进度条值时遇到问题
- 你说:
如何计算任务进度
实现目标的方法
准确:使用websocket检测任务的进度更改,并更新进度条值
可能不太准确:或者通过ajax定期请求数据库更新进度条值。